Using a scart to s-vhs and audio or a converter with s-vhs cable from
Digibox to Video projector - s-vhs connection only B&W - even says so on projector menu - composite input is fine and colourful - what am I missing? I've tried changing Pal settings (M,N etc) but no difference. TIA |

"Peter G" wrote thanks - sorry - yes - s-video - only thing on digibox (Goodmans GDB3) is CVBS - changed to that - TV scart still colour but Projector (auxillary scart) still B&W when s-video and colour when on composite. Have tried different make projector (one NEC other InFocus) but still no joy. The GDB3 does not do s-video, only composite (aka CVBS) or RGB. John Howells |
